16.3 sec in total
568 ms
15.5 sec
265 ms
Click here to check amazing Aibi Fitness content for Singapore. Otherwise, check out these important facts you probably never knew about aibifitness.com
Wide range of fitness equipment for home. Located in Singapore, Malaysia, Taiwan, China. Specialize in home exercise machine, slimming device and solutions. LED or EMS slimming devices. Carry internat...
Visit aibifitness.comWe analyzed Aibifitness.com page load time and found that the first response time was 568 ms and then it took 15.7 sec to load all DOM resources and completely render a web page. This is a poor result, as 90% of websites can load faster.
aibifitness.com performance score
name
value
score
weighting
Value17.1 s
0/100
10%
Value23.5 s
0/100
25%
Value43.3 s
0/100
10%
Value1,560 ms
13/100
30%
Value0.233
53/100
15%
Value109.2 s
0/100
10%
568 ms
1835 ms
239 ms
1641 ms
1126 ms
Our browser made a total of 314 requests to load all elements on the main page. We found that 93% of them (293 requests) were addressed to the original Aibifitness.com, 1% (4 requests) were made to Googletagmanager.com and 1% (3 requests) were made to Fonts.gstatic.com. The less responsive or slowest element that took the longest time to load (3 sec) belongs to the original domain Aibifitness.com.
Page size can be reduced by 1.8 MB (62%)
2.9 MB
1.1 MB
In fact, the total size of Aibifitness.com main page is 2.9 MB. This result falls beyond the top 1M of websites and identifies a large and not optimized web page that may take ages to load. 80% of websites need less resources to load and that’s why Accessify’s recommendations for optimization and resource minification can be helpful for this project. CSS take 1.8 MB which makes up the majority of the site volume.
Potential reduce by 183.7 kB
HTML content can be minified and compressed by a website’s server. The most efficient way is to compress content using GZIP which reduces data amount travelling through the network between server and browser. HTML code on this page is well minified. It is highly recommended that content of this web page should be compressed using GZIP, as it can save up to 183.7 kB or 87% of the original size.
Potential reduce by 5.1 kB
Image size optimization can help to speed up a website loading time. The chart above shows the difference between the size before and after optimization. Aibi Fitness images are well optimized though.
Potential reduce by 33.3 kB
It’s better to minify JavaScript in order to improve website performance. The diagram shows the current total size of all JavaScript files against the prospective JavaScript size after its minification and compression. It is highly recommended that all JavaScript files should be compressed and minified as it can save up to 33.3 kB or 13% of the original size.
Potential reduce by 1.6 MB
CSS files minification is very important to reduce a web page rendering time. The faster CSS files can load, the earlier a page can be rendered. Aibifitness.com needs all CSS files to be minified and compressed as it can save up to 1.6 MB or 87% of the original size.
Number of requests can be reduced by 261 (86%)
305
44
The browser has sent 305 CSS, Javascripts, AJAX and image requests in order to completely render the main page of Aibi Fitness. We recommend that multiple CSS and JavaScript files should be merged into one by each type, as it can help reduce assets requests from 228 to 1 for JavaScripts and from 35 to 1 for CSS and as a result speed up the page load time.
aibifitness.com
568 ms
aibifitness.com
1835 ms
calendar.css
239 ms
styles-m.css
1641 ms
bootstrap-grid.min.css
1126 ms
amslick.min.css
681 ms
mageb-quote-style.css
938 ms
styles.css
741 ms
owl.carousel.min.css
762 ms
animate.css
1358 ms
fontawesome5.css
1480 ms
mgz_font.css
1042 ms
mgz_bootstrap.css
1171 ms
openiconic.min.css
1308 ms
styles.css
1572 ms
common.css
1404 ms
styles.css
1540 ms
magnific.css
1582 ms
styles.css
1871 ms
photoswipe.css
1723 ms
default-skin.css
1774 ms
blueimp-gallery.min.css
1796 ms
styles.css
1807 ms
owl.carousel.css
1867 ms
perfect-scrollbar.min.css
1969 ms
stripe_payments.css
2007 ms
style.css
2020 ms
grid-mageplaza.css
2031 ms
font-awesome.min.css
2101 ms
magnific-popup.css
2103 ms
styles-l.css
2952 ms
css
55 ms
settings_consumer.css
2472 ms
all.css
65 ms
font-awesome.min.css
56 ms
shape_up_your_life_3_1.jpg
2240 ms
adidas_2.png
2253 ms
aibi-gym.png
2329 ms
aibi-club.png
2331 ms
aibi-jumpsport.png
2464 ms
js
68 ms
require.js
2691 ms
mixins.js
2338 ms
requirejs-config.js
1898 ms
polyfill.js
1962 ms
stripe_payments.js
1956 ms
consumer_0.js
1871 ms
consumer_0_addition.js
1770 ms
aibi-spirit.png
1801 ms
aibi-teeter.png
1770 ms
vibro.png
1782 ms
bodysolid_1.png
1733 ms
cellreturn.png
1686 ms
hoist.png
1725 ms
lifefitness.png
1666 ms
lumidiet_1.png
1715 ms
lumitone.png
1707 ms
nohrd.png
1722 ms
octanefitness.png
1682 ms
reebok.png
1795 ms
refa.png
1773 ms
slendertone.png
1764 ms
sixpad.png
1701 ms
truefitness.png
1719 ms
tuffstuff.png
1622 ms
tunturi_1.png
1635 ms
css
19 ms
waterower.png
1621 ms
preloader-img.svg
1670 ms
quote-icon-active.png
1645 ms
Fitness2-overlay.jpg
810 ms
Health4-overlay2.jpg
1050 ms
Beauty1-overlay.jpg
856 ms
roadshow_v3.jpg
856 ms
fbevents.js
107 ms
events.js
188 ms
gtm.js
105 ms
font
152 ms
athlete2.woff
813 ms
font
205 ms
opensans-400.woff
890 ms
opensans-300.woff
926 ms
opensans-600.woff
979 ms
opensans-700.woff
979 ms
opensans-800.woff
1059 ms
font
268 ms
jquery.js
1666 ms
jquery.mobile.custom.js
1148 ms
common.js
1153 ms
dataPost.js
1178 ms
bootstrap.js
1182 ms
translate-inline.js
1301 ms
mage-translation-dictionary.js
1379 ms
responsive.js
1356 ms
theme.js
1377 ms
js
209 ms
analytics.js
203 ms
destination
102 ms
main.MWNkMWZjOGNjMA.js
63 ms
linkid.js
67 ms
collect
14 ms
collect
29 ms
ga-audiences
130 ms
domReady.js
257 ms
jquery.js
394 ms
template.js
438 ms
confirm.js
439 ms
widget.js
450 ms
main.js
452 ms
bootstrap.js
613 ms
translate.js
547 ms
dialog.js
544 ms
jquery-ui.js
547 ms
text.js
481 ms
tabs.js
519 ms
matchMedia.js
655 ms
effect.js
673 ms
jquery.cookie.js
673 ms
underscore.js
463 ms
modal.js
476 ms
scripts.js
531 ms
jquery-migrate.js
609 ms
waypoints.js
599 ms
knockout.js
762 ms
knockout-es5.js
523 ms
engine.js
512 ms
bootstrap.js
630 ms
observable_array.js
733 ms
bound-nodes.js
726 ms
mage.js
690 ms
button.js
704 ms
draggable.js
831 ms
position.js
902 ms
resizable.js
949 ms
js-translation.json
916 ms
core.js
901 ms
collapsible.js
901 ms
modal-popup.html
827 ms
modal-slide.html
884 ms
modal-custom.html
897 ms
key-codes.js
932 ms
observable_source.js
706 ms
renderer.js
708 ms
console-logger.js
847 ms
knockout-repeat.js
767 ms
knockout-fast-foreach.js
780 ms
resizable.js
819 ms
i18n.js
822 ms
scope.js
835 ms
range.js
998 ms
mage-init.js
989 ms
keyboard.js
1004 ms
optgroup.js
1052 ms
after-render.js
1051 ms
autoselect.js
1079 ms
datepicker.js
1212 ms
outer_click.js
1274 ms
fadeVisible.js
1228 ms
collapsible.js
1283 ms
staticChecked.js
1283 ms
simple-checked.js
1321 ms
bind-html.js
1432 ms
tooltip.js
1370 ms
color-picker.js
1465 ms
wrapper.js
1424 ms
events.js
1407 ms
es6-collections.js
1452 ms
mouse.js
1423 ms
jquery.storageapi.extended.js
1318 ms
class.js
1171 ms
loader.js
1164 ms
local.js
1093 ms
logger.js
1091 ms
entry-factory.js
1160 ms
console-output-handler.js
1179 ms
formatter.js
1257 ms
message-pool.js
1258 ms
levels-pool.js
1325 ms
logger-utils.js
1335 ms
async.js
1298 ms
registry.js
1319 ms
slider.js
1228 ms
main.js
1172 ms
calendar.js
1078 ms
moment.js
1102 ms
tooltip.html
883 ms
spectrum.js
807 ms
tinycolor.js
901 ms
jquery.storageapi.min.js
776 ms
entry.js
632 ms
template.js
574 ms
dom-observer.js
446 ms
bindings.js
470 ms
arrays.js
463 ms
compare.js
464 ms
misc.js
529 ms
objects.js
578 ms
strings.js
561 ms
datepicker.js
525 ms
timepicker.js
635 ms
MutationObserver.js
361 ms
FormData.js
235 ms
print.css
235 ms
loader.js
235 ms
require-cookie.js
231 ms
page-cache.js
276 ms
sticky.js
237 ms
megamenu.js
230 ms
modal.js
447 ms
form-mini.js
450 ms
mpsearch.js
453 ms
validation.js
467 ms
trim-input.js
467 ms
modal-wishlist.js
492 ms
app.js
681 ms
dropdown.js
673 ms
modal-minicart.js
679 ms
mobile-menu.js
700 ms
form.js
688 ms
cookies.js
725 ms
block-loader.js
885 ms
section-config.js
889 ms
invalidation-processor.js
897 ms
honeypot.js
926 ms
captcha.js
919 ms
loader.js
969 ms
analytics.js
1107 ms
carousel.js
1113 ms
customer-data.js
1128 ms
customer-data-mixin.js
1150 ms
alert.js
953 ms
velocity.min.js
1004 ms
perfect-scrollbar.jquery.min.js
1120 ms
animation.transition.end.js
927 ms
price-utils.js
1021 ms
jquery.autocomplete.min.js
1017 ms
validation.js
1009 ms
types.js
839 ms
layout.js
888 ms
block-loader.html
689 ms
element.js
703 ms
owl.carousel.min.js
503 ms
url.js
568 ms
storage.js
580 ms
jquery.validate.js
278 ms
loader-1.gif
232 ms
miniquote.js
256 ms
collection.js
278 ms
image.js
330 ms
minicart.js
383 ms
totals.js
429 ms
totals.js
460 ms
authentication-popup.js
492 ms
loginCaptcha.js
526 ms
social-buttons.js
580 ms
wishlist.js
620 ms
messages.js
650 ms
storage-manager.js
673 ms
provider.js
716 ms
messages.js
738 ms
messages-mixin.js
822 ms
links.js
849 ms
jquery.metadata.js
688 ms
sidebar.js
651 ms
sidebar.js
594 ms
form.js
475 ms
login.js
558 ms
authentication-popup.js
611 ms
defaultCaptcha.js
567 ms
captchaList.js
591 ms
provider.js
589 ms
storage-service.js
535 ms
product-ids-resolver.js
577 ms
effect-blind.js
585 ms
messageList.js
615 ms
api.js
24 ms
recaptcha__en.js
48 ms
website-rule.js
458 ms
compat.js
511 ms
decorate.js
534 ms
effect-fade.js
556 ms
spinner.js
575 ms
resolver.js
603 ms
adapter.js
625 ms
captcha.js
552 ms
ids-storage.js
468 ms
data-storage.js
554 ms
ids-storage-compare.js
566 ms
product-ids.js
512 ms
messages.js
490 ms
accordion.js
467 ms
autocomplete.js
494 ms
droppable.js
577 ms
effect-bounce.js
579 ms
effect-clip.js
609 ms
effect-drop.js
678 ms
effect-explode.js
699 ms
effect-fold.js
724 ms
effect-highlight.js
809 ms
effect-scale.js
803 ms
effect-pulsate.js
834 ms
effect-shake.js
923 ms
effect-slide.js
931 ms
effect-transfer.js
957 ms
menu.js
1026 ms
progressbar.js
1043 ms
selectable.js
1059 ms
sortable.js
1167 ms
spinner.js
1163 ms
tabs.js
1189 ms
tooltip.js
1249 ms
buttons.js
1130 ms
refresh.js
1084 ms
query-builder.js
1060 ms
aibifitness.com accessibility score
ARIA
These are opportunities to improve the usage of ARIA in your application which may enhance the experience for users of assistive technology, like a screen reader.
Impact
Issue
[aria-*] attributes do not match their roles
ARIA IDs are not unique
Names and labels
These are opportunities to improve the semantics of the controls in your application. This may enhance the experience for users of assistive technology, like a screen reader.
Impact
Issue
Buttons do not have an accessible name
Links do not have a discernible name
Navigation
These are opportunities to improve keyboard navigation in your application.
Impact
Issue
Heading elements are not in a sequentially-descending order
aibifitness.com best practices score
Trust and Safety
Impact
Issue
Does not use HTTPS
Includes front-end JavaScript libraries with known security vulnerabilities
Ensure CSP is effective against XSS attacks
General
Impact
Issue
Detected JavaScript libraries
aibifitness.com SEO score
Crawling and Indexing
To appear in search results, crawlers need access to your app.
Impact
Issue
Links are not crawlable
Mobile Friendly
Make sure your pages are mobile friendly so users don’t have to pinch or zoom in order to read the content pages. [Learn more](https://developers.google.com/search/mobile-sites/).
Impact
Issue
Document uses legible font sizes
Tap targets are not sized appropriately
EN
EN
UTF-8
Language claimed in HTML meta tag should match the language actually used on the web page. Otherwise Aibifitness.com can be misinterpreted by Google and other search engines. Our service has detected that English is used on the page, and it matches the claimed language. Our system also found out that Aibifitness.com main page’s claimed encoding is utf-8. Use of this encoding format is the best practice as the main page visitors from all over the world won’t have any issues with symbol transcription.
aibifitness.com
Open Graph description is not detected on the main page of Aibi Fitness. Lack of Open Graph description can be counter-productive for their social media presence, as such a description allows converting a website homepage (or other pages) into good-looking, rich and well-structured posts, when it is being shared on Facebook and other social media. For example, adding the following code snippet into HTML <head> tag will help to represent this web page correctly in social networks: